Easy hiking trails around Kallham, nestled in the Hausruckviertel region of Upper Austria, offer a blend of natural beauty and cultural points of interest. The landscape is characterized by rolling hills, forests, and scenic vistas, providing varied terrain suitable for easy walking paths. Hikers can expect to explore charming countryside and discover local landmarks. This area is ideal for family-friendly outings and beginner hiking routes.

The Schillerlinde stands on the Kalvarienberghöhe above Neumarkt i.H. and was named after it was planted with a simple granite stone in 1905 on the 100th anniversary of the death of Friedrich von Schiller.

Kallham and the surrounding Hausruckviertel region offer a wide selection of easy hiking trails. There are over 110 easy routes available, with a total of more than 200 hiking tours of varying difficulty levels.
The easy hikes around Kallham are characterized by the charming landscape of the Hausruckviertel. You can expect rolling hills, tranquil forests, and scenic vistas across the countryside. The terrain is generally gentle, making it ideal for relaxed walks.
Yes, the easy hiking trails in Kallham are very suitable for beginners. They feature gentle elevation changes and well-maintained paths, allowing for a comfortable introduction to hiking in the region.
Many of the easy hiking trails around Kallham are perfect for families. They offer manageable distances and minimal elevation, providing a pleasant outdoor experience for all ages. For example, the Granatzweg Riedau loop from Riedau is a popular choice with gentle terrain.
Generally, dogs are welcome on hiking trails in Upper Austria. However, it's always advisable to keep your dog on a leash, especially in nature reserves or near livestock. Ensure you carry water for your pet and clean up after them.
Yes, Kallham offers several easy circular hiking routes. These loops allow you to start and end at the same point, providing convenience. A great example is the Lignorama Wood and Tool Museum loop from Riedau, which takes you through local woodlands.
While hiking easy trails around Kallham, you can discover various points of interest. The Zell an der Pram Castle – Lignorama Wood and Tool Museum loop from Riedau combines natural scenery with cultural sights. Additionally, the region is home to several castles like Aistersheim Water Castle and Schloss Zell an der Pram, which can be explored as part of or near your hiking routes.
The best time for easy hiking in Kallham is typically from spring through autumn (April to October). During these months, the weather is generally mild and pleasant, and the natural scenery is at its most vibrant. Summer offers lush greenery, while autumn brings beautiful fall colors.
Kallham and nearby towns like Neumarkt-Kallham offer local amenities including cafes and pubs where you can stop for refreshments or a meal after your hike. Many routes pass through or near villages with such facilities.
The easy hiking trails around Kallham are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 300 reviews. Hikers often praise the quiet, charming countryside, the well-maintained paths, and the blend of natural beauty with cultural points of interest.
Easy hikes around Kallham vary in length, but many can be completed within 1 to 2 hours. For example, the Granatzweg Riedau loop from Riedau is about 4.1 miles (6.6 km) and takes approximately 1 hour 48 minutes.
While specific public transport connections directly to every trailhead might vary, the region around Kallham is generally accessible. It's advisable to check local bus or train schedules for connections to towns like Riedau or Neumarkt-Kallham, from where many easy trails begin.
